Virtual Assistant Manager information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a virtual assistant man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Virtual Assistant Manager, you need strong organizational skills, experience in remote team supervision, and a background in administration or business management. Familiarity with project management tools like Asana or Trello, video conferencing platforms, and cloud-based document systems is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ability help you excel in leading distributed teams and addressing client needs. These skills ensure efficient workflow coordination, clear virtual collaboration, and high-quality client service in a remote work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by virtual assistant managers when overseeing remote teams, and how can they be addressed?

Virtual Assistant Managers often encounter challenges such as coordinating tasks across different time zones, maintaining clear communication, and fostering team engagement remotely. To address these, it's essential to implement effective project management tools, establish regular check-ins, and set clear expectations for deliverables. Building a sense of community through virtual team-building activities and providing ongoing feedback can also enhance collaboration and productivity in a remote environment.

What is a virtual assistant manager?

Virtual Assistant Managers are professionals who oversee and coordinate teams of virtual assistants, ensuring efficient workflow and high-quality support services for clients or organizations. They are responsible for assigning tasks, monitoring performance, providing training, and resolving issues that arise within the team. Virtual Assistant Managers often work remotely themselves and utilize digital tools to manage communication and productivity. Their role is essential in maintaining organization, meeting deadlines, and ensuring client satisfaction in a virtual work environment.

Job description

Wing Assistant is building the next generation of AI-enabled workforce solutions for growing businesses. We help companies get high-quality support across roles like executive assistance, admin support, customer support, sales support, recruiting support, operations support, and other business functions.

Our growth depends on a steady flow of qualified opportunities, and we are hiring a Go-to-Market Associate to help create them. This person will sit at the front line of our revenue motion: identifying companies with active hiring needs, reaching out with a compelling alternative to traditional hiring, and booking qualified meetings for our sales team.

This is a high-energy, high-ownership role for someone early in their career who wants to learn fast, build real outbound skills, and grow into bigger roles across sales, growth, revenue, or go-to-market strategy over time.

It is a great fit for someone who is competitive, well-organized, motivated by clear targets, and genuinely curious about how AI, remote talent, and global workforce solutions are changing the way companies build teams.

What You'll Do

Generate Qualified Opportunities

  • Identify companies actively hiring for roles Wing can support, such as Executive Assistants, Admin Assistants, Customer Support, Sales Support, Recruiting Support, Operations Support, and other business support roles.
  • Use job postings, hiring signals, company growth signals, and account research to find strong-fit prospects.
  • Research target accounts to understand what they are hiring for, why they may need support, and where Wing could be a strong fit.
  • Reach out to prospective customers across email, phone, LinkedIn, and other outbound channels.
  • Run focused outbound campaigns around active hiring needs, operational pain points, and alternative workforce solutions.
  • Hold early discovery conversations to understand a prospect's hiring needs, pain points, urgency, and openness to remote talent or AI-enabled workforce solutions.
  • Communicate what Wing Assistant does and why it matters clearly enough to earn the next meeting.
  • Book qualified appointments with companies that have a clear hiring need, relevant business use case, or strong fit for Wing.

Turn Hiring Intent Into Conversations

  • Monitor companies that are posting roles Wing can service.
  • Understand what the company is likely trying to solve by hiring that role.
  • Position Wing as a faster, more flexible, and more scalable alternative to traditional hiring.
  • Educate prospects who may not have considered remote assistants, virtual assistants, offshore talent, or AI-enabled workforce support before.
  • Create curiosity with founders, executives, operators, HR leaders, recruiting teams, and department heads.

Support the Revenue Team

  • Work closely with the sales team to build and protect a healthy, well-qualified pipeline.
  • Hand off opportunities cleanly, with the context needed to move conversations forward.
  • Share key details from discovery calls, including the role the company is hiring for, their current hiring process, pain points, timing, budget signals, and decision-makers involved.
  • Keep activity, notes, and pipeline data accurate and current in our CRM.

Bring the Market Back In

  • Feed what you are hearing from prospects back to the Sales, Marketing, and Product teams.
  • Help refine messaging and outreach based on what is actually landing with companies.
  • Identify patterns in hiring demand, objections, industries, and roles where Wing is resonating.
  • Suggest new outbound angles based on job postings, hiring trends, and prospect conversations.
